As the excitement continues to mount for the Paris 2024 Paralympic Games, the women’s wheelchair basketball field is now complete following the conclusion of the 2024 IWBF Women’s Repechage at the Asue Arena in Osaka, Japan. The tournament, held from 17 April to 20 April, showcased intense competition as teams vied for their chance to compete on the world stage. Japan, Canada, Germany, and Spain emerged as the four triumphant teams, securing their spots in the prestigious Paralympic Games. As thhe countdown to the Paris 2024 Paralympic Games intensifies, the last four men’s wheelchair basketball teams secured their spots following the successful conclusion of the inaugural 2024 IWBF Men’s Repechage tournament. The Netherlands, Germany, Canada, and host nation France cemented their places after four days of intense battles at the Azur Arena Antibes. They join the USA, Great Britain, Spain, and Australia, who secured their berths through their respective Zonal Championships. The 2024 Easter Wheelchair Basketball Tournament held in Blankenberge over the Easter Weekend proved to be a thrilling showcase of talent and sportsmanship. Six formidable teams, including Australia, Netherlands, Italy, France, Colombia, and Germany, competed fiercely from Friday to Sunday. Five of these teams were gearing up for the 2024 IWBF Men’s Repechage event, while Australia was focused on their preparations for Paris 2024.
